NHTSA Campaign 22V870000
STEERING:CRITICAL FASTENERS
Issued by Navistar, Inc. · Reported Nov 23, 2022 · 5,645 vehicles affected
What's wrong
Navistar, Inc. (Navistar) is recalling certain 2023 IC CE, EV, and RE vehicles. The hex flange lock nuts, used in the suspension and steering joints, were improperly heat treated and may lose tension over time.
Consequence
A loss of tension in the steering and suspension joints may lead to steering instability and increase the risk of a crash.
Remedy
Dealers will replace the hex flange lock nuts as necessary, free of charge. Owner notification letters are expected to be mailed January 20, 2023. Owners may contact Navistar's customer service at 1-800-448-7825. Navistar's number for this recall is 22525.
